The body of the person found dismembered in the front trunk of a car registered to singer D4vd has reportedly been identified as being a girl between the ages of 14 and 15, according to law enforcement sources that spoke with ABC News. NBC 4 also reported that the victim was between 14 and 15 after speaking to law enforcement, citing the results from forensics.
As reported by TMZ and later confirmed to Complex, the Los Angeles County Medical Examiner identified the body but declined to release their name until a next of kin was notified.
According to ABC News, a next of kin has yet to be located and the Los Angeles County medical examiner’s office has not determined a cause of death. Per Rolling Stone, the body was first discovered on September 8 in the trunk of a 2023 Tesla Model Y that was registered to D4vd, real name David Anthony Burke. The car was impounded in a tow yard in the Hollywood Hills and raised suspicion due to a foul odor that emanated from the vehicle.
“She appears to have been deceased inside the vehicle for an extended period of time before being found. We are unable to determine her age or race/ethnicity,” the medical examiner said in a previous statement.
Burke, who is 20, has yet to publicly comment on the situation. The artist’s rep has said that the singer is cooperating with the authorities. “D4vd has been informed about what’s happened. And, although he is still out on tour, he is fully cooperating with the authorities,” a spokesperson for D4vd said, per NBC 4. The singer’s Withered World Tour is set to wrap in Los Angeles on Sept. 20 and is scheduled to continue in Europe starting on on Oct. 1.
